What does Type A vs Type B mean?
Type A. Serious citation. Imminent or substantial risk to children. The regulator requires corrective action immediately and may impose a civil penalty.
Type B. Lower-severity citation. Corrective action required, no imminent risk. The regulator monitors compliance on the next visit.
- 1569.312(d)Type A
Basic services requirementsEvery facility required to be licensed under this chapter shall provide at least the following basic services: ...Being aware of the resident's general whereabouts, although the resident may travel independently in the community. This requirement was not met as evidenced by: Based on LPA Jensen's review of an incident report and the written account received by email from local law enforcement officer, resident R5 was outside of the facility and reported as missing from the afternoon of 4/20/23 to the morning of 4/21/23. This poses an immediate threat to the health, safety and personal rights of resident in care.
